
以下是连接两个切片的正确方法:package main import "fmt" func main() { slice1 := []int{1, 2} slice2 := []int{3, 4} // 使用 ... 将 slice2 展开为可变参数 result := append(slice1,...

例如,考虑以下两个列表:arr = [100, -23, -23, 404, 100, 23, 23, 23, 3, 404] mem = [0, 10, 10, 10, 1, 10, 10, 10, 10, 10]如果直接使用 print(f"arr = {arr}") 这样的方式输出,结果会是:...

以下是几种常见的C++对象序列化方法。 不安全的密码存储方式很容易导致数据泄露,给用户带来极大的风险。 示例(Zap): logger, _ := zap.NewProduction() defer logger.Sync() logger.Info("用户登录", zap.String("user...

核心在于理解`predict_proba`的输出特性,并在创建包含预测概率的dataframe时,显式地利用原始输入数据帧的索引,随后通过`pd.concat`进行可靠的列合并,从而避免数据错位,保证分析结果的准确性。 '); } }, error: function(xhr, status, er...

比如原本不敢拆出的高频调用小服务,在引入 Istio 或 Linkerd 后,可通过重试、超时、熔断机制保障稳定性。 如果时间间隔不固定,可能会影响 EMA 的计算结果。 serveSingle("/sitemap.xml", "./sitemap.xml") serveSingle("/favic...

我们需要对它们进行严格的验证 (Validation) 和 净化 (Sanitization)。 要定期审视和优化你的中间件链。 也可以结合使用(虽然没必要):多数编译器会优化重复保护,但不推荐冗余写法。 针对缺乏现有库支持的新兴语言环境,我们将重点介绍感知哈希(Perceptual Hashing...

一个健壮的Go程序应该使用适当的同步原语来管理Goroutine的生命周期和程序的退出。 当你使用yield return时,它会返回一个元素给调用者,并暂停当前方法的执行。 '; echo '</video><br>'; } 注意:确保 uploads/ 目录有写权限,并且...

关键在于调整我们的建模思维和方法,以适应Go的语言特性。 这时候,就需要std::weak_ptr出场了,它能打破这种循环,但这也意味着你需要额外地去思考和设计对象之间的关系。 小对象优先值类型,大对象或需共享状态用指针,同时注意零值和初始化逻辑。 </p> <a href="lo...

我们将比较使用 append 动态增长切片与使用 make 预分配内存的两种实现方式,并分析它们在代码风格和潜在性能上的差异,帮助开发者选择最适合其场景的方案。 5. 总结 解决WordPress插件开发中PancakeSwap API数据不显示的问题,需要仔细检查以下几个方面: API请求是否成功...

解包时遇到ValueError: not enough values to unpack (expected 3, got 2)怎么办? 总结与最佳实践 Go语言在处理map和reduce这类数据转换与聚合模式时,倾向于使用显式的for循环和可变切片。 在C++中统计字符串中某个字符出现的次数,有多...